Description

The HFCT-5760xxx Small Form Factor Pluggable LC optical transceivers are high performance, cost effective modules for serial data transmission at a signal rate of 155 Mbit/s.

Features

  • Compliant with ITU-T G.957 STM1 S1.1 (15 km) and L1.1 (40 km) Optical Interface.
  • Compliant with Telcordia GR253 OC3 IR-1 (15 km) and LR-1 (40 km) Optical Interface.
  • Multi-Source Agreement (MSA) compliant SFP package.
  • Hot-pluggable.
  • Multirate operation from 125 Mb/s to 155 Mb/s.
  • Operating case temperature ranges: -40 to +85 °C (ATL/ATL/ANL/ANP) -10 to +85 °C (TL/TP/NL/NP).
  • Optional extended de-latch for high density.

www.DataSheet4U.com Agilent HFCT-5760TL/TP/NL/NP/ATL/ ATP/ANL/ANP Single Mode OC-3/ STM-1 Small Form Factor Pluggable Transceivers Part of the Agilent METRAK family Data Sheet Description The HFCT-5760xxx Small Form Factor Pluggable LC optical transceivers are high performance, cost effective modules for serial data transmission at a signal rate of 155 Mbit/s. The transceivers are compliant with SONET/SDH and the Small Form Factor Pluggable (SFP) Multi-Source Agreement (MSA) specifications. They are designed for intermediate and long reach applications at 155 Mbit/s. The transceivers operate at a nominal wavelength of 1300 nm over single mode fiber.
